Small pub campsite in rural Herefordshire, 15 minutes’ from Hay-on-Wye
We offer camping for tents and campervans in the grounds of our riverside pub in the village of Michaelchurch Escley in Herefordshire. There are grassy terraces for family tents and small tents and a flat area with electric hook-up for campervans. And if you’re thirsty after setting up…the pub beckons!
We have two flat terraces for tents and a large flat area for campervans - and the pub is only a stone’s throw away
There are five flat pitches with electric hook-up for campervans
Facilities at the Bridge Inn campsite
- We have space for x3 family tents, x10 small tents, x5 campervans with electric hook-up
- There are x5 loos
- There are x2 showers (one male, one female) and x1 washing up sink

Camping prices*
Prices below include camping all year round
• Adults £10 per night
• Children (under 12 years) £5 per night
• Electric hook-up (an additional £2 daily charge)
